Overview
RONGJIDA CA-3 concrete gas content tester is a direct reading instrument for measuring the gas content in concrete mixtures. It is suitable for concrete with aggregate particle size greater than 40mm, gas content not more than 10% and slump. The body of the instrument is made of all aluminum casting and is equipped with a shockproof and waterproof pressure gauge, which is especially suitable for on-site operation. It can directly read the gas content value. The operation is simple and the numerical value is accurate, eliminating the tedious steps of drawing and calibrating Linear dispersion.

Principle
The measurement principle of the CA-3 direct reading concrete gas content tester is based on the gaseous equation. Between the gas chamber maintaining a certain pressure and the container filled with the test material, the pressure is equilibrated by opening and closing. When the pressure of the two containers reaches the equilibrate, the reduction of the pressure of the gas chamber is equal to the percentage of the air content in the mortar, which is directly displayed on the pressure gauge as the air content in the test material. The instrument is also suitable for the measurement of the air content in the mortar according to the relevant technical conditions.
